Here are your 2 options here. Get a stroller that you can lie all the way back. Since babies should not be sitting in a stroller until they can sit unassisted. Or get a stroller where you have the option of putting the stroller onto. So like an adapter bar.
For the first option I would suggest a Chicco Liteway or Joovy Kooper.
For the second option my personal favorite is the City Mini.
